The human body uses oxygen in cellular respiration to create energy by oxidizing carbohydrates (mostly sugars), fats, or protein. This process produces carbon dioxide, water, and other chemical by-products. The carbon dioxide is brought through the bloodstream to the lungs, where it is exchanged for more oxygen. The lungs exhale the carbon dioxide along with some water vapor and substantial remaining oxygen.
